Assessing Your Machine's Capabilities
Before implementing any changes, assess your machine's current resource usage and capabilities. Tools like htop or top can provide real-time insights into CPU, memory, and storage usage. Additionally, consider the age and specifications of your hardware, as these factors can impact performance.
Optimizing Sync Processes
To optimize sync processes on older machines, consider the following:
- Schedule sync processes during off-peak hours to minimize resource contention.
- Use incremental backups to reduce the amount of data transferred and processed.
- Implement data compression to further reduce the amount of data transferred.
- Limit the number of simultaneous sync processes to avoid overwhelming the system.
Off-Site Backup Solutions for Older Machines
Selecting the right off-site backup solution is crucial for maintaining data security and minimizing resource usage. Consider the following options:
- Cloud-based solutions: Services like AWS S3, Google Cloud Storage, and Microsoft Azure offer scalable, secure, and cost-effective options for off-site backups.
- Dedicated backup servers: If cloud-based solutions are not feasible, consider setting up a dedicated backup server on-premises or at a colocation facility.
- Hybrid solutions: Combine cloud-based and on-premises solutions to balance data security, cost, and performance.
